Corrugated metal siding repair services focus on restoring the integrity and appearance of metal panels used on various types of properties. These services typically involve assessing the extent of damage, removing compromised sections, and replacing or patching panels to ensure the structure remains weather-resistant and visually appealing. Skilled contractors may also perform cleaning and sealing to prevent future corrosion or deterioration, helping to maintain the property's durability over time. The goal is to address issues promptly and effectively, minimizing the risk of further damage caused by exposure to the elements.

This service is essential for resolving common problems associated with corrugated metal siding, such as rust, corrosion, dents, punctures, and loose or missing panels.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and physical impacts can weaken metal siding, leading to leaks or structural vulnerabilities. Repair services help prevent these issues from escalating, protecting the underlying structure from water infiltration and potential damage. Proper repairs can also improve the overall aesthetic of the property, giving it a well-maintained appearance.

Properties that frequently utilize corrugated metal siding include industrial buildings, warehouses, agricultural structures, and commercial facilities. Additionally, some residential properties incorporate metal siding for modern architectural styles or as a durable exterior option. These structures often require repair services to address wear and tear, weather-related damage, or aesthetic updates. Metal siding is valued for its longevity and low maintenance requirements, but when issues arise, professional repair services ensure that the siding continues to perform effectively.

The overview below groups typical Corrugated Metal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Washington County, RI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for corrugated metal siding repair ranges from $300 to $1,200 depending on the extent of damage and size of the area.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ive work can approach the higher end of the spectrum.

Material and Labor Expenses - Material costs for replacement panels generally fall between $10 and $20 per square foot, with labor fees adding an additional $50 to $100 per hour. Larger projects tend to increase overall expenses accordingly.

Factors Influencing Cost - Costs can vary based on the type of metal, the complexity of the repair, and accessibility of the site. For example, repairs on difficult-to-reach areas may incur higher labor charges.

Cost Estimates Range - Overall, repair projects in Washington County, RI, and nearby areas typically cost between $500 and $2,500.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ific repair need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Corrugated Metal Siding Repair services address issues such as rust, dents, and corrosion that can compromise the integrity of metal siding on buildings. Local contractors can assess damage and perform necessary repairs to restore the siding’s appearance and functionality.

Leak Repair for Corrugated Metal Siding involves fixing gaps, holes, or damaged seams that may lead to water infiltration. Professionals can identify sources of leaks and provide effective sealing or patching solutions.

Rust and Corrosion Restoration services focus on removing rust and treating affected areas to prevent further deterioration. Skilled service providers can apply protective coatings to extend the lifespan of metal siding.

Panel Replacement Services are available for sections of siding that are severely damaged or beyond repair. Local pros can replace individual panels to match existing siding and maintain the building’s exterior appearance.

Surface Preparation and Recoating services involve cleaning and priming the metal surface before applying new protective coatings. This process helps prevent future corrosion and maintains the siding’s durability.

Preventative Maintenance for Corrugated Metal Siding includes inspections and minor repairs to address issues early. Maintenance services can help prolong the life of metal siding and keep it in good condition.

What types of damage can be repaired on corrugated metal siding? Repairs typically address issues such as rust spots, dents, punctures, loose panels, and corrosion damage. Contact local service providers to assess specific damage and determine suitable repair options.

How long does corrugated metal siding repair usually take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age and the size of the affected area. Local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ific repair needs.

Is it possible to repair corrugated metal siding without replacing entire panels? Yes, many damages can be fixed through patching, sealing, or panel replacement of individual sections. Consult local pros for options suited to the damage.

What maintenance is recommended to prevent future damage to corrugated metal siding? Regular inspections for rust, debris removal, and prompt repairs to minor issues can help prolong the siding’s lifespan. Local service providers can offer tailored maintenance advice.
